Block 21,568
Block Hash
99669161da21ac38a8ad01e6abc703a87ee430660c0db0b1696c0c54a5548c28
Previous Block Hash
10a65d3aeba80065c1baaae7bf2ed631853e38929bc8ec252575d1e0d0fe257f
Mined
Transactions
1
Difficulty
124.36 K
Size
247 bytes
Transactions (1)
1 input, 1 output
500,000.00
PEPE